Dive into the timeless swing and cool jazz sounds of Woody Herman with the 2000 remastered release of "Four Brothers." This album, originally recorded by the legendary big band leader, is a vibrant collection of 15 tracks that showcase Herman's distinctive style and the prowess of his orchestra. From the opening notes of "Early Autumn" to the playful rhythms of "Goosey Gander," each piece is a testament to the golden era of jazz.
The album spans a rich variety of compositions, including well-known standards like "Laura" and "Woodchopper's Ball," as well as lesser-known gems like "Bijou (Rhumba à la Jazz)" and "Rhapsody in Wood." Woody Herman's band delivers an impeccable blend of swing, cool jazz, and big band sounds, making this album a delightful journey through the evolution of jazz.
Recorded in 2000 and released under the Dreyfus Jazz label, this remastered edition brings new clarity and depth to the original recordings, allowing both longtime fans and new listeners to appreciate the intricate arrangements and dynamic performances.
